
Sitio Web Facebook Twitter Instagram TV a la Carta
ITV is a commercial television channel in the United Kingdom. Previously a network of separate regional television channels, ITV currently operates in England, Wales, Scotland and the Channel Islands.
Sitio Web Facebook Twitter Instagram TV a la Carta